Site Safety Specialist

Huntsman is seeking a Site Safety Specialist supporting the Shared Services located in The Woodlands, Texas. This position will report to the Waterway Facility Manager.

Job Scope

The Waterway Office Site Safety Specialist role is the primary point of contact for all safety and security related activities in the Waterway Office.  This includes the promotion, coordination, communication, and awareness training for all personnel safety programs, policies, and initiatives as well as coordination with the Property Management group for all building life safety systems and drills.

Roles and responsibilities:

 With limited supervision and moderate decision-making:

  • Administrative (procedures, metrics, audits, training materials, permitting)       
  • Site Security (primary POC, access control coordination, physical security, cameras)
  • Life Safety (fire system w/prop.mgmt, fire wardens, drills, training/awareness)
  • Office Safety (Zero Harm, division/group interactions, communications)
  • Building Communications (after hours work, impairments, inspections, documentation)
  • Other (HR POC random drug testing, wellness room support)
  • Facility Manager back up (POC in manager absence)

What We Do

Huntsman Corporation is a publicly traded global manufacturer and marketer of differentiated and specialty chemicals with 2019 revenues of approximately $7 billion. Our chemical products number in the thousands and are sold worldwide to manufacturers serving a broad and diverse range of consumer and industrial end markets. We operate more than 70 manufacturing, R&D and operations facilities in approximately 30 countries and employ approximately 9,000 associates within our four distinct business divisions.
